zl程序教程

您现在的位置是:首页 >  系统

当前栏目

Linux下Qt音频播放:轻松享受音乐乐活力(linux下qt音频播放)

LinuxQt 轻松 音乐 播放 音频 享受 活力
2023-06-13 09:18:53 时间

Linux是一款开源的操作系统,它提供多种功能和功能强大的管理工具,可以高效的完成任务。Qt是一款流行的开源图形界面框架,使用它可以方便的完成复杂的应用开发。此外,Qt在Linux下提供音频播放功能,可以让用户轻松享受音乐乐活力。

Linux下Qt音频播放可以支持常见的音频格式,包括MIDI、WAV、MP3、FLAC等等,这些都是流行的多媒体格式。使用Qt的音频播放API,可以支持多路音频播放、混合等功能。

在Linux下Qt音频播放中,首先要包含头文件:

`c++

#include


然后,定义QIODevice类的实例以读取文件,执行下面的代码:
```c++QFile inputFile("audio.mp3");
if(inputFile.open(QIODevice::ReadOnly)) { QAudioFormat format;
//set format type ...
QAudioOutput* audioOutput = new QAudioOutput(format, this); ...
QIODevice* device = audioOutput- start();
if(device) { //read file ...
} }

上面的代码片段将MP3文件读取到内存中,并使用QAudioOutput启动一个播放进程。然后,使用QIODevice的start方法开始音频的播放,使用read方法读取文件内容,从而完成音频文件的播放,让用户轻松享受音乐乐活力。

此外,Linux下Qt音频播放还可以支持不同音频设备,比如麦克风、耳机等,灵活选择不同设备做出不同的播放效果,这加深了用户听音乐的乐趣,也让用户体会更多创意。

总而言之,Linux下Qt音频播放,可以让操作简单,轻松享受音乐乐活力,深受用户的喜爱。快来体验一下Qt音频播放的魅力吧!


我想要获取技术服务或软件
服务范围:MySQL、ORACLE、SQLSERVER、MongoDB、PostgreSQL 、程序问题
服务方式:远程服务、电话支持、现场服务,沟通指定方式服务
技术标签:数据恢复、安装配置、数据迁移、集群容灾、异常处理、其它问题

本站部分文章参考或来源于网络,如有侵权请联系站长。
数据库远程运维 Linux下Qt音频播放:轻松享受音乐乐活力(linux下qt音频播放)